U.S. patent number D953,455 [Application Number D/785,988] was granted by the patent office on 2022-05-31 for skipping rope.
The grantee listed for this patent is Healthy Kuaiche (Shanghai) Education Technology Co., Ltd.. Invention is credited to Mei Li.

Description
FIG. 1 is a front and top perspective view of a skipping rope,
showing my new design;
FIG. 2 is a rear and bottom perspective view thereof;
FIG. 3 is a front elevation view thereof;
FIG. 4 is a rear elevation view thereof;
FIG. 5 is a left side elevation view thereof;
FIG. 6 is a right side elevation view thereof;
FIG. 7 is a top plan view thereof;
FIG. 8 is a bottom plan view thereof;
FIG. 9 is an enlarged view of a portion labeled, `FIG. 9` in FIG.
1; and,
FIG. 10 is an enlarged view of a portion labeled, `FIG. 10` in FIG.
2.
The broken lines in the figures illustrate portions of the skipping
rope that form no part of the claimed design. The dash dot dash
lines in FIGS. 1, 2, 9 and 10 are for the purpose of depicting the
cut line of the enlarged view and form no part of the claim.
